As Europe’s largest airline group carrying over 600K guests on over 3,600 daily flights, we are looking for the next generation of cabin crew to join us in the Autumn/Winter months at one of our 90+ operational bases. Flying on board Ryanair Group aircraft there are some amazing perks, including; discounted staff travel to over 250+ destinations across the Ryanair network, a fixed 5/3 roster pattern, free training & industry-leading pay.

Your journey to becoming a qualified cabin crew member will start on a 6-week training course where you will learn all of the fundamental skills that you will require as part of your day-to-day role delivering a top-class safety & customer service experience to our guests. During the course you will be required to study with exams taking place at regular intervals, the training culminates with Supernumerary flights, followed by your Cabin Crew Wings.

As a member of the Ryanair Group cabin crew family, you will be immersed into our culture from day one, the career opportunities are endless including becoming a number 1, base supervisor, Regional Manager or why not aspire to becoming our Director of Inflight?

Life as Cabin Crew is fun & rewarding, it is however a demanding position where safety is our number 1 priority. You will be required to operate both early & late shifts & report for duty as early as 5 am in the morning on the early roster & not return home until midnight on the afternoon roster. If you are not a morning person, then think twice before applying!

Some of our amazing benefits:

  • Daily per Diem whilst training – £28 per day
  • Free Internationally recognised Cabin Crew Training Course
  • Uncapped Sales bonus
  • Unlimited highly discounted Staff Travel
  • Fixed 5 days on / 3 days off roster pattern
  • The adventure and experience of a lifetime within our Cabin Crew network
  • Explore new cultures and cities with colleagues on your days off
  • Free Uniform in Year 1 and annual allowance afterwards
  • Security of working for a financially stable Airline

Requirements:

  • Applicants must hold the unrestricted right to live and work in the EU and travel freely throughout the Ryanair Network
  • You must approximately be between 5 “2 (157 cm) and 6” 2 (188 cm) in height.
  • You must be able to swim 25 meters unaided.
  • It helps if you are hardworking, flexible and have an outgoing and friendly personality.
  • Adaptable and happy to work a shift roster.
  • Enjoy dealing with the public and have the ability to provide excellent customer service with a ‘can do’ attitude.
  • Comfortable speaking and writing in English with ease.
  • A passion for travelling and meeting new people.
